Accessibility:

Small car park for up to 12 cars with no height restrictions, laid to tarmac. Pushchair friendly trails (shortest trail). The longer trail has steep and rocky areas. No toilets,picnic area, visitor centre, catering or reception staff. Dogs welcome on their leads. Please be advised there is no lighting in the car park or along the trails, suitable footwear is needed.

Amenities:

Nearest amenities can be found in Swansea.

Brief Description:

A peaceful woodland with two walking trails to enjoy. Plenty of bird life to be seen throughout the year in the woods and along the river.
